Course Rundown
The BSB50420 Diploma of Leadership and Management, offered by the Engineering Institute of Technology, is a comprehensive program designed to equip engineering and technical professionals with essential leadership and management skills. Over the course of 12 months, participants will delve into key areas such as financial planning, negotiation, operational planning, people management, project management, and conflict resolution. This diploma not only focuses on theoretical knowledge but also incorporates practical applications relevant to the engineering and technical sectors, ensuring that graduates are well-prepared to lead and manage effectively in their respective fields.
Throughout the program, students will engage in interactive learning experiences, including live webinars and assessments that reinforce their understanding of core concepts. The curriculum begins with foundational units on workplace relationships and team dynamics, progressing to more complex topics such as emotional intelligence and business strategy. By the end of the course, participants will have developed a robust skill set that enables them to navigate the challenges of leadership and management within an engineering context, making them valuable assets to any organisation.
This nationally accredited qualification is delivered online, making it accessible to a diverse range of students. With a focus on real-world applications and industry-relevant content, the BSB50420 Diploma of Leadership and Management prepares individuals for various roles, including project manager, operations manager, and engineering supervisor. Eligibility
To be eligible to study this course, applicants must meet the following entry requirements:
- Must either be in relevant employment or have access to appropriate workplace environments to achieve the competency standard units required for completion and,
- Satisfactory English language proficiency at an English pass level in a Senior Certificate of Education or equivalent; OR
- A specified level of achievement in a recognized English language test such as: IELTS (or equivalent) at a score of at least 5.5 (with no individual band score less than 5.0); or equivalent; OR
- Satisfactory completion of another course offered by EIT, or by another tertiary institution, in English.
